Как работают хранилища данных и машины
Нынешние цифровые службы работают благодаря сотрудничеству двух основных элементов. Серверы выполняют требования юзеров и производят операции. Базы данных хранят данные в упорядоченном формате. Понимание основ деятельности помогает разобраться в принципах функционирования vavada casino цифровых сервисов и сервисов.
Почему за каждым ресурсом и приложением скрывается незаметная инфраструктура
Пользователи замечают только интерфейс софта или страницы. За внешней оболочкой скрывается запутанная инженерная структура. Серверное аппаратура располагается в дата-центрах и поддерживает постоянную деятельность службы. Хранилища хранения сведений хранят миллионы сведений о клиентах, операциях и контенте.
Структура осуществляет жизненно важные функции. Она выполняет входящие обращения от тысяч клиентов параллельно. Компоненты платформы контролируют права входа и оберегают конфиденциальную данные. вавада казино организует связь между разными модулями сервиса. Без устойчивой технологической основы невозможно создать надёжный виртуальный сервис.
Что такое машина и зачем он требуется цифровому решению
Машина представляет собой машину с значительной мощностью, который обрабатывает обращения пользовательских устройств. Программное софт управляет входом к мощностям и распределяет нагрузку. вавада казино отвечает за логику функционирования программы и взаимодействие с хранилищами сведений. Без серверной компонента неосуществима работа актуальных веб-сервисов.
Как база данных содержит сведения и позволяет быстро ее обнаруживать
Хранилище данных структурирует сведения в таблицы, файлы или графы. Упорядоченное размещение даёт моментально извлекать требуемые данные. vavada casino применяет особые механизмы для оптимизации входа к сведениям.
Производительность деятельности достигается различными механизмами:
- Индексы создают указатели на часто востребованные информацию
- Кэширование записывает частые обращения в памяти
- Партиционирование дробит большие таблицы части фрагменты
- Репликация копирует информацию на несколько узлов
Правильная структура хранилища уменьшает время ответа и улучшает производительность сервиса.
Что совершается, когда юзер открывает сайт или сервис
Пользовательское гаджет посылает обращение на машину через сеть. Обращение несёт сведения о требуемой странице или команде. Машина анализирует запрос и устанавливает нужные сведения для реакции.
Система обращается к хранилищу для доставки нужных записей. vavada casino выполняет поиск по определённым критериям и выдаёт результаты. Машина выполняет информацию и генерирует HTML-документ или JSON-ответ. Готовый итог передается на устройство пользователя. Браузер или приложение отображает сведения на экране. Весь операция требует части секунды при грамотной оптимизации.
Соединение между машиной, хранилищем данных и клиентским интерфейсом
Клиентский интерфейс представляет визуальную компонент сервиса. Кнопки и формы отправляют команды на серверную часть. Машина является связующим между клиентом и репозиторием данных. Он принимает обращения и создаёт запросы к информации.
вавада извлекает нужную информацию из таблиц. Сервер конвертирует итоги в вид для пользовательского сервиса. Информация поступают в интерфейс для показа. Многоуровневая структура разделяет функции между модулями. Такое разделение упрощает проектирование и сопровождение решения. Каждый уровень обновляется автономно от остальных элементов.
Почему информацию необходимо не лишь сохранять, а правильно структурировать
Неструктурированное размещение информации ведёт к замедленной функционированию архитектуры. Поиск необходимой записи среди миллионов компонентов требует значительное период. Правильная структура повышает доступ и уменьшает трафик на аппаратуру.
Нормализация устраняет дублирование и экономит физическое объём. Отношения между таблицами обеспечивают сохранность данных. вавада обеспечивает непротиворечивость сведений при одновременных обновлениях. Индексирование ключевых атрибутов создает оперативные маршруты доступа. Продуманная организация базы улучшает устойчивость и эффективность всего сервиса.
Реляционные и нереляционные базы данных: в чем разница на реальности
Реляционные платформы организуют данные в таблицы со строгой организацией. Соединения между таблицами поддерживают непротиворечивость данных. Язык SQL даёт производить сложные обращения и комбинировать сведения из множественных источников.
Нереляционные решения применяют гибкие форматы размещения. Документоориентированные системы записывают сведения в JSON-структурах. Графовые хранилища заточены для работы со отношениями между сущностями.
вавада казино определяется в соответствии от нужд системы. Реляционные применимы для операционных систем с четкой схемой. Нереляционные гарантируют масштабируемость и гибкость организации данных.
Как обращения позволяют доставать необходимую информацию из репозитория
Запросы являются собой инструкции для извлечения или модификации данных. Язык SQL позволяет формулировать параметры выборки и сортировки записей. Платформа устанавливает оптимальный метод реализации команды.
Главные категории действий с информацией:
- Отбор данных по заданным критериям
- Внесение новых элементов в таблицы
- Изменение текущих параметров
- Стирание неактуальной информации
vavada casino ускоряет обработку обращений с благодаря индексов. Сложные обращения комбинируют сведения из нескольких таблиц. Агрегатные функции рассчитывают общие и арифметические значения. Грамотно составленные обращения увеличивают доставку результатов.
Функция API в обмене данными между приложениями
API составляет софтверный интерфейс для сотрудничества между системами. Интерфейс задаёт принципы передачи информацией и схемы передачи данных. Системы применяют API для доступа опций других программ.
REST API действует через HTTP-протокол и использует стандартные способы обращений. Юзер передаёт запрос с параметрами. Сервер анализирует запрос и возвращает ответ в виде JSON. вавада отдаёт данные через API для сторонних приложений.
Механизмы позволяют интегрировать платежные платформы, карты и общественные сети. Разработчики разрабатывают блочные приложения с связью через API. Такой подход ускоряет масштабирование платформы.
Почему производительность сервера влияет на функционирование всего продукта
Период реакции сервера устанавливает темп отображения веб-страниц и выполнения команд. Замедленная выполнение команд уменьшает результативность. Каждая избыточная секунда ожидания поднимает долю уходов.
Скорость техники влияет на число синхронно обрабатываемых обращений. Слабая мощность процессора порождает скопления и простои. Оперативная ОЗУ ограничивает размер сохраняемых данных.
Доработка кода увеличивает результативность работы. Производительный машина гарантирует приятное работу с приложением. Эффективность инфраструктуры сказывается на лояльность клиентов и результативность сервиса.
Как серверы обрабатывают с значительным количеством юзеров
Увеличение аудитории создает повышенную нагрузку на архитектуру. Один сервер не в_состоянии обслуживать миллионы команд параллельно. Платформы задействуют различные подходы для распределения нагрузки.
Горизонтальное расширение добавляет новые узлы. Балансировщик распределяет поступающие запросы между узлами. Каждый машина обслуживает долю потока. Вертикальное расширение повышает производительность аппаратуры.
Группы работают как целостная система и предоставляют надёжность. При сбое единственной узла прочие продолжают обслуживать пользователей. Правильная структура обеспечивает выполнять увеличивающийся трафик без ухудшения уровня.
Распределение нагрузки
Балансировка запросов между множеством узлами вавада избегает перегрузку системы. Балансировщик анализирует моментальную занятость машин и перенаправляет трафик на меньше загруженные узлы. Динамическое включение машин случается при росте числа юзеров. Платформа адаптируется в соответствии от актуальной нужды в технических ресурсах.
Кэширование и разделение команд
Буфер записывает часто востребованные данные в скоростной памяти. Последующие обращения к информации не нуждаются запросов к базе. Распределенный буфер находится на ряде узлах для увеличения объема. CDN предоставляет неизменяемый содержимое из ближайших к юзеру узлов. Такие механизмы сокращают трафик на центральную инфраструктуру и ускоряют отклик архитектуры.
Безопасность данных: охрана, запасные бэкапы и контроль доступа
Защита данных нуждается комплексного подхода на всех уровнях архитектуры. Шифрование информации блокирует незаконный проникновение при прослушивании трафика. Механизмы безопасности вавада казино гарантируют приватность передачи сведений.
Механизм надзора входа лимитирует привилегии юзеров в зависимости от роли. Аутентификация удостоверяет легитимность учетных профилей. Периодическое создание запасных бэкапов защищает от утраты информации при сбоях.
Бэкапы размещаются на отдельных узлах или в виртуальных хранилищах. Программное дублирование производится по расписанию. Процедуры восстановления позволяют моментально вернуть функциональность системы.
Что совершается при сбоях и как архитектуры возвращаются
Системные аварии появляются по различным причинам: отказ аппаратуры, баги приложений, переполнение сети. Платформы мониторинга контролируют статус элементов и сигнализируют о проблемах. Автоматические механизмы активируют процедуры реанимации.
Основные этапы реанимации функциональности:
- Определение проблемы через наблюдение
- Передача потока на дублирующие серверы
- Восстановление сведений из копий
- Ликвидация сбоя
Копирование сведений на ряд узлов поддерживает бесперебойность деятельности. При поломке единственного узла система использует запасные копии. Время восстановления определяется от архитектуры архитектуры.
Почему хранилища данных и машины продолжают базисом цифрового окружения
Всякий актуальный цифровой продукт нуждается устойчивого хранения и выполнения сведений. Серверы vavada casino осуществляют расчёты и синхронизируют работу программ. Репозитории данных обеспечивают оперативный получение к данным. Развитие методов не упраздняет базовые принципы организации. Осознание устройства системы способствует строить результативные и расширяемые решения.
